          • 2.Like clockwork,nearly every fourth February includes one extra day.February 29th,also known as Leap Day,isn't exactly a holiday.Instead,it's there to make your calendar agree with the earth's rotation (旋轉) around the sun.
               According to history,Roman emperor Julius Caesar is the "father" of Leap Year.Until he came along,people had used a 355-day calendar,which was 10.25 days shorter than the solar year.Roman officials were supposed to add an extra month every now and then to keep the seasons exactly where they should be.But that didn't work out all that well.When special occasions started shifting into different seasons around 45 BCE,Caesar asked experts for advice and then announced that the empire should use a 12-month,365-day calendar,which he named after himself.Caesar's Julian calendar included a Leap Day every four years.
            Though Leap Day makes your calendar match the earth's rotation around the sun,it causes a different kind of problem for leapsters.When should these February 29th babies celebrate their birthdays during the other three-quarters of their lives?Some party on February 28th,while others prefer a two-day celebration that lasts from the last day of February to the first day of March.
               Leap Day can be a nuisance in the legal system.In 2006,a court in USA was deciding whether criminal John Melo could be set free two days early since his 10-year sentence included two Leap Days.In the case,the judge decided that since the man was sentenced to prison for years,not days.Leap Day didn't make a bit of difference.
               Though a few timekeepers have pushed for calendars that don't include Leap Day,almost all experts and societies agree that Leap Day is the best method to keep the calendar working well.

          • 4.The Internet is full of headlines that grab your attention with buzzwords (流行詞).But often when we click through,we find the content hardly delivers and it wastes our time.We close the page,feeling we've been cheated.These types of headlines are called "click bait".
                A headline on Businesslnsider.com reads: "This phrase will make you seem more polite".First,when you click through,you find another headline: "Four words to seem more polite." Then,on reading the article,you find it's actually an essay about sympathy.And what are the four words?They're "Wow,that sounds hard." On some video websites,you might encounter headlines such as "Here's what happens when six puppies visited a campus".Turns out it's just some uneventful dog footage (鏡頭).
               Nowadays,with the popularity of social media,many news outlets tweet (推送) click bait links to their stories.These tweets take advantage of the curiosity gap or attempt to draw the reader into a story using a question in the headline.These click bait headlines are so annoying that someone is attempting to save people time by exposing news outlet click bait through social media.The Twitter account @SavedYouAClick,run by Jake Beckman,is one such example.
               Beckman's method is to grab tweets linking to a story and retweet them with a click-saving comment.For example,CNET tweeted "So iOS 8 appears to be jailbreakable but…",with a link to its coverage of Apple's product announcements.Beckman retweeted it with this comment attached: "…it hasn't been jailbroken yet."
               Since founding the account,Beckman's Twitter experiment has brought him more than 131,000 followers.Beckman said that @SavedYouAClick is…"just my way of trying to help the Internet be less temble." Asked about his goal,he said, "I'd love to see publishers think about the experience of their readers first.I think there's an enormous opportunity for publishers to provide readers with informative updates that include links so you can click through and read more.
